Ring artifact reduction via multiscale nonlocal collaborative filtering of spatially correlated noise

TL;DR: In this article, the authors proposed a streak removal procedure based on additive stationary correlated noise upon logarithmic transformation, where the Block-Matching and 3D (BM3D) filtering algorithm is applied across multiple scales, achieving state-of-the-art performance.

Coded aperture imaging for fluorescent x-rays

TL;DR: In this paper, a coded aperture pattern in front of a charge couple device (CCD) pixilated detector was employed to image fluorescent xrays (6-25 keV) from samples irradiated with synchrotron radiation.
